kin- marker used for 'you' (subject) acting on 'us' (object)

Dictionary Entry
lexicon ID #3842 | revised Aug 12 2014

kin- PREF • marker used for 'you' (subject) acting on 'us' (object)


Sentence examples (4)


Display mode: sentence | word | word components

  1. xas    yítha    upíip    "hûut    kumá'ii    patá    kin'íchunva   
    then    one    she.said    how    because.of    that    you.hide.us   
    Then one of them said, "What for did you hide us?
    Source: Margaret Harrie, "The Ten Young Men who Became the Pleiades" (DAF_KT-02) | read full text
  2. koovúra    îin    kinimúustiheesh   
    all    TOPIC    you.are.looking.at.us   
    You (one person) are going to look at us.
    Source: Vina Smith, Sentences about looking and talking to people (VS-36) | read full text
    Spoken by Vina Smith | Download | Play
  3. vaa    kúth    kin'áhachakutih   
    so    because.of    you.were.withholding.it.from.us   
    For that purpose you held out on us."
    Source: Lottie Beck, "The Greedy Father" (WB_KL-23) | read full text
  4. xás    pa'avansáxiich    ukpêehva    kinvítivrik   
    then    the.boy    he.shouted    you.row.to.meet.us   
    And the boy shouted, "Row to meet us!"
    Source: Julia Starritt, "The Bear and the Deer" (WB_KL-32) | read full text
